The Bailey Olympus Series 2 460-2 is a masterfully crafted two-berth caravan that perfectly balances lightweight agility with premium comfort. Built using Bailey’s innovative Alu-Tech bodyshell construction, this model offers enhanced thermal insulation and structural integrity, making it a reliable companion for year-round touring. Inside, the 460-2 feels remarkably spacious for its footprint, featuring a generous front lounge that easily converts into a large double bed or two comfortable singles, complemented by high-quality soft furnishings and gloss-finish cabinetry.
The rear of the caravan is dedicated to a full-width washroom, providing a level of luxury often reserved for much larger models. This washroom includes a separate walk-in shower cubicle, a large wardrobe, and a modern vanity unit, ensuring a home-from-home experience on the road. The central kitchen is equally well-appointed, boasting a Thetford refrigerator and a stainless steel microwave to satisfy all your culinary needs. At 1,276kg MTPLM, your tow car needs a kerbweight of at least 1,501kg to meet the 85% guideline. Check towing capacity by reg or use the towing calculator to compare a specific car and caravan.
The Bailey Olympus Series 2 460-2 has approximately 137kg of user payload. This must cover all personal belongings, water, gas, awning, and accessories. Overloading affects handling and is illegal.
Request a habitation check or damp survey for any used caravan. Check the service history, tyre age, chassis condition, and whether the CRIS registration matches the seller. Specifications vary by year and trim level.

The Bailey Olympus Series 2 460-2 is a 6.13 metre two-berth caravan designed for couples seeking a balance of lightweight towing and high-specification features. Built with the Alu-Tech bodyshell, it provides a durable, timberless structure and a spacious end-washroom layout. With an MTPLM of 1276kg, it remains accessible to many family cars while offering premium amenities like a full-width dressing area and a well-equipped central kitchen.
Worth knowing: The 137kg payload requires careful management of heavy equipment. Worktop space is restricted when using both the sink and the 4-burner hob. Strictly limited to two berths, making it unsuitable for families.
Worth knowing: Payload is limited to 137kg, which must cover all personal effects and gas bottles. The 2.19 metre width is narrower than some modern luxury ranges, affecting aisle space.
| Model | Berths | MTPLM | Length | Typical price |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Bailey Olympus Series 2 460-2 | 2 | 1276 kg | 6.13 m | £8,500 to £12,500 |
| Bailey Pageant Monarch | 2 | 1295 kg | 6.45 m | £5,500 to £9,500 |
| Swift Finesse 400 | 2 | 1209 kg | 5.99 m | £11,500 to £21,000 |
The Bailey Olympus Series 2 460-2 sits in a competitive segment, offering a robust Alu-Tech build that distinguishes it from traditional timber-framed rivals. While the Swift Sprite Alpine 2 and Lunar Venus 460-2 offer lighter MTPLM figures for those with very small tow cars, the Bailey provides a high-specification interior with gloss finishes and a full-width washroom. The choice between these models often depends on whether the buyer prioritises the structural benefits of the Alu-Tech shell over the slightly higher payload or lower weight of its competitors.
